Transaction 0176971676a62c23c4dd1e3c52aae6d4f407c46e3040c63908a9882a0cb0a0f6
1 Input
1 Output
-
0176971676a62c23c4dd1e3c52aae6d4f407c46e3040c63908a9882a0cb0a0f6:0
- value
- 5013025
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 93b323bdaf7da8bf3ece85d5d395126939fe21a2 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1ETxw3BV2tprsbh6a4bH1joRaBXvL92TwN